CONSENT AGENDA
Items are placed on the consent agenda when staff recommends approval or recommends
approval with stipulations that the applicant agrees to. Any member of the public desiring
to speak on a consent agenda item may sign up and be heard prior to voting on the
consent agenda. Commissioners may request to remove any item from the consent
agenda and have it placed on the individual consideration agenda. All items on the
consent agenda will be considered for approval by one motion adopting the items with
staff findings and recommendations.
